About Peoria Civic Center (Theater)

Located in Peoria, Illinois, Peoria Civic Center (Theater) is a theater that first opened its doors in 1982. Currently, it’s under the ownership of City of Peoria.


Peoria Civic Center (Theater) Seating

Peoria Civic Center (Theater) has a total capacity of 2,173. However, this figure can vary for events with unique venue configurations.

Peoria Civic Center (Theater) Bag Policy & Prohibited Items

Every guest is permitted to bring either one (1) clear plastic, vinyl, or PVC bag, not surpassing 12” x 6” x 12”, or one (1) one-gallon clear plastic bag. Additionally, each guest can carry one (1) small clutch, not exceeding 5” x 8”. Diaper bags (accompanied by a child aged three and under) and bags containing medically necessary items will be allowed, subject to a visual inspection by security.

How to Get to Peoria Civic Center (Theater)

Peoria Civic Center (Theater) is located at 201 Sw Jefferson St., Peoria, Illinois, 61602. We've got you covered with all the options to get there, from public transportation to convenient rideshares.

Rideshare Drop-off and Pickup Location

At Peoria Civic Center (Theater), there are specific pick-up locations for rideshare users. You’ll find the designated pick-up spots at SW Jefferson St., in front of the venue.
